Output aab864ae702fe3f32d3bdeb6b43986ae020bf936705b2b92b03e8728183562aa:1

value
3090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453250429827bec82cecb6769f800600afb1149d OP_EQUAL
address
37ztpdAsc6y4xJrvcD36BRyG2AfanrfFKZ
transaction
aab864ae702fe3f32d3bdeb6b43986ae020bf936705b2b92b03e8728183562aa
confirmations
433359
spent
true